Challenges in Visual Identification
Determining the sex of a groundhog visually is inherently difficult for several reasons. Groundhogs exhibit minimal external sexual dimorphism, meaning males and females look very similar in their overall body shape and features. Their dense fur can also obscure any minor physical differences. Additionally, groundhogs are naturally shy and wary creatures, making close or sustained observation challenging. Their secretive nature means they often retreat into their burrows at the first sign of human presence. Therefore, relying solely on a quick glance in the field is rarely sufficient for accurate sex determination.
Observable Physical and Behavioral Indicators
Despite the challenges, some subtle physical and behavioral cues might offer hints about a groundhog’s sex. Male groundhogs are typically slightly larger and heavier than females, with average weights ranging from 8 to 14 pounds, while females usually weigh between 5 and 10 pounds. Males may also have a broader head and a more muscular build. However, these size differences can vary significantly depending on age, individual groundhogs, and the time of year, as groundhogs gain considerable weight in the autumn before hibernation. Behavioral observations can provide additional clues, especially during the breeding season from early March to late April. Males emerge from hibernation earlier than females and become more active, searching for mates and engaging in territorial displays. Observing a groundhog with young offspring is a strong indicator that it is a female, as females are responsible for caring for their litters. Females also tend to have smaller home ranges and may occupy burrows closer to each other than males.
Understanding the Limitations of Observation
Accurately determining the sex of a groundhog through casual observation remains largely speculative. Definitive sex determination typically requires direct physical examination. This involves identifying the presence of a baculum, or penis bone, which is found in male groundhogs, or visible mammary glands in females. Mammary glands may be particularly noticeable in females that are pregnant or nursing. Such direct examination is generally only feasible through professional trapping, handling, or close veterinary and scientific observation. These methods are not practical or advisable for the general public in the wild. Without these intrusive measures, any conclusion about a groundhog’s sex based solely on visual cues or observed behaviors should be considered an educated guess rather than a certainty.
